Massachusetts AI Coalition to Host Launch Event Across the Commonwealth

February 12, 2026, is set to be a significant day for the artificial intelligence sector in Massachusetts, as the Massachusetts AI Coalition hosts its launch event. The coalition, a newly formed group of companies, investors, and innovators, will hold events in multiple locations throughout the state, including Boston, Cambridge, Holyoke, and Worcester.

The launch event, announced by Ryan Durkin, aims to connect founders, operators, investors, and builders actively involved in developing and shipping AI products. According to Durkin, over 1,000 requests to join have already been received from experienced professionals, students, and others eager to participate in the coalition’s initiatives.

The Massachusetts AI Coalition was officially announced on January 12, 2026, by WHOOP, the human performance company. The coalition is designed to strengthen collaboration and accelerate the adoption of AI across various industries within the Commonwealth, including technology, manufacturing, healthcare, and finance. The group intends to encourage growth for existing companies and attract new businesses to Massachusetts.

The coalition boasts a diverse membership, encompassing both early-stage startups and established global companies. Founding members include WHOOP, Suno, Lovable, DraftKings, Wayfair, HubSpot, Klaviyo, Circle, Hi Marley, Blitzy, Phoenix Tailings, Duckbill, Jellyfish, Formlabs, Agency Inc., and 7AI. This broad representation underscores the coalition’s ambition to foster a comprehensive AI ecosystem within the state.

The launch event will feature gatherings at three different venues in Boston and Cambridge: a company headquarters, a venture capital firm, and a university. The coalition plans to host events throughout the year, organized around five key tracks: Learn, Build, Connect, Launch, and Party. The “Learn” track will offer workshops on topics such as agentic coding and large language models (LLMs). The “Build” track will facilitate hackdays focused on prototyping. “Connect” events will provide networking opportunities, while “Launch” events will celebrate new products, and companies. The “Party” component acknowledges the importance of fostering a vibrant and enjoyable community for those working in the AI field.

The coalition believes Massachusetts possesses the necessary ingredients to become a leading global hub for artificial intelligence, citing its world-class universities, innovative companies, and talented workforce. The launch event at WHOOP’s headquarters in Kenmore Square is intended to galvanize this potential and establish a collaborative framework for future growth. Attendees will have the opportunity to meet key figures driving AI innovation in Massachusetts and contribute to shaping the coalition’s plans for the coming year.
